Onion And Tomato Gravy

Ingredients

* 3 medium onions, chopped
* 3 cloves garlic, chopped
* 1/2 inch ginger, chopped
* 1/2 cup tomato paste
* salt
* 2 tablespoons yoghurt
* ghee
* water

To be made into a paste

* 1 teaspoon cumin seed
* 1 teaspoon coriander seed
* 3-4 dry kashmiri chilies
* 7 black peppercorns
* 3/4 teaspoon turmeric powder
* 3 cloves

Directions
1.Dry roast the cumin, corriander, red chillies, cloves, peppercorns and turmeric on a frying pan/ a flat bottomed tava.
2.Grind with a little water to make a paste.
3.Heat ghee or oil in a pan.
4.Fry onions and garlic until golden in colour.
5.Add ground spices and ginger.
6.Fry until the oil begins to separate.
7.Add tomato paste, yoghurt and salt.
8.Keep frying, stirring continuously.
9.After a few minutes, add enough warm water to make a gravy.
10.Cook for 8-10 minutes.
11.Add your choice of vegetables/meat now and cook until the veggies/meat is tender and ready to eat.

Kadhai Gravy

500 ml of gravy

Ingredients

* 5 1/2 tablespoons ghee
* 4 teaspoons garlic paste
* 4 tablespoons coriander seeds, pounded with a pestle
* 9 whole red chilies, pounded with a pestle
* 2 tablespoons ginger, chopped
* 3 cups tomatoes, washed and chopped
* 5 green chilies, de-seeded and chopped
* 1 tablespoon dried rose petal
* salt
* 1 teaspoon garam masala

Directions
1. Heat ghee in an iron-cast wok (kadhai).
2. Add garlic paste.
3. Saute over low heat until light brown in colour.
4. Add the pounded corriander seeds and red chillies.
5. Saute for half a minute.
6. Add the ginger and green chillies.
7. Saute for another half a minute.
8. Add the chopped tomatoes.
9. Cook until the ghee separates and floats on the surface.
10. Add the rose petals, salt and garam masala.
11.Stir and mix well.
12. Add the vegetables of your choice and cook until the veggies are tender.
13. Serve hot with rotis/naan/parathas/bread- you name it!

Cheese Toast

SERVES 1

Ingredients

* 2 cups self raising flour
* salt
* grated cheese
* 1 teaspoon black pepper
* 1 teaspoon ginger and chili paste
* 2 teaspoons gram flour (besan)
* coriander leaves
* water
* 2 slices bread

Directions
1. Mix the first 7 ingredients to make a dough by adding water.
2.Take one slice of bread and apply the above made paste on one side.
3. Take a non-stick pan and put the paste side of the bread below.
4. Apply some oil/butter on the plain top side of the bread.
5. Cook the bread on both sides.
6. Once cooked, cut it into 2 triangular-shaped pieces and serve with Tomato Ketchup or any chutney of your choice.

Three Colour Rajma Salad

A very nutritious low-calorie veggie enjoyable salad!

SERVES 4

Ingredients

* 2 cups rajma, soaked overnight and boiled
* 1 cup macaroni, boiled
* 1/2 cup green capsicum, chopped
* 1/2 cup cucumber, chopped
* 1/2 cup spring onion
* 1/4 teaspoon mustard powder
* 2 teaspoons salt
* black pepper
* 2 tablespoons lemon juice

Directions
1.Toss all in a bowl and serve!
